Situation

The property is located on Prospect Road, a well-established area of Osbaston with far reaching views of the neighbouring Monmouthshire countryside. The property is also within walking distance of a local pub and a bus route. Monmouth’s excellent High Schools, both private and comprehensive. Osbaston Primary School are within walking distance. There are open fields surrounding this well-established residential area offering plentiful dog walks. There are excellent connections to the main road network with the A40 within a five-minute drive providing good connections to the M4 in the South and M50 / M5 to the North. Bristol is just 30 miles away, Cardiff 35 miles. The nearest railway stations are Lydney 13 miles away and Abergavenny 17 miles. Monmouth town offers plenty of well supported local businesses and shops as well as an M&S food hall and a Waitrose.
